Re: Need help choosing tires.

Just went wheeling last weekend with brand new Baja MTZs. I love the tire. It has very good grip on the rocks. On the highway, I didn't feel that the handling got worse. You will get road noise, but its acceptable. It also looks really sweet. THe only thing I don't like about them is that it chips easily on the sidewall compared to Toyo's and Pro Comps.

Anyways, here are pictures of my tires on stock size. Also I lost about 4-5 MPG as soon as I installed the tires.
